In recent trading, Dow Jones futures rose as President Trump suggested that an agreement with Iran might be close, noting that the vital Strait of Hormuz has been “opened.” The comment appeared to ease concerns about Middle East supply disruptions, which previously had helped push oil prices higher. The broader market has been weighing the dual influences of geopolitical developments and corporate earnings against the backdrop of a still-uncertain economic outlook. Separately, Tesla’s stock has been moving upward, with analysts pointing to improved delivery figures and renewed interest in the company’s electric vehicle lineup. Several AI-focused stocks are also trading near levels that could act as technical entry points, though no specific price targets are widely cited. The technology sector has generally benefited from strong demand for artificial intelligence hardware and software, and the latest earnings reports from major players have reinforced that narrative. Market participants are watching these developments closely as they assess both the macro environment and sector-specific trends. The presence of multiple potential catalysts—a possible Iran deal and renewed momentum in high-growth tech—has contributed to a cautiously optimistic tone in futures trading. Key takeaways from the day’s developments center on the interaction between geopolitics and equity markets. If a U.S.-Iran agreement is finalized, it could lead to a reduction in oil price volatility and potentially lower energy costs, which might benefit a wide range of consumer and industrial sectors. However, such a scenario remains uncertain, and any breakdown in talks could reignite supply fears. For Tesla and AI stocks, the proximity to “buy points” suggests that technical traders may be looking for confirmation of upward breakouts. Fundamentals such as recent earnings growth and product updates support the narrative, but the broader market’s direction still hinges on interest rate expectations and overall economic health. The AI sector, in particular, continues to attract capital flows due to its long-term growth story. Market observers also note that the Dow’s futures movement reflects a mix of optimism over the Iran news and caution ahead of upcoming economic data releases. Cross-border tensions remain a variable that could shift sentiment quickly. From an investment perspective, the potential Iran deal represents a geopolitical event that could have far-reaching implications for commodity prices and global trade. While reduced oil premiums might ease inflationary pressures—a positive for equities—investors should remain aware that any agreement would need to pass congressional and international scrutiny. The opening of the Strait of Hormuz, if confirmed, would signal a de-escalation that markets have been pricing in only partially. For growth stocks like Tesla and AI companies, the current price levels could offer entry points for those with a long-term horizon, but momentum-driven rallies carry inherent risks. Without explicit analyst price targets or confirmed earnings beats, any move higher may rely on sustained market confidence. A cautious approach would involve monitoring upcoming earnings reports and macroeconomic data rather than acting solely on technical patterns. Broader market conditions remain mixed, with the Federal Reserve’s policy path and consumer spending trends still key variables. The interplay between positive geopolitical news and persistent economic uncertainty suggests that volatility could persist in the near term.
